Accident summary

On Saturday 30 December 2000 at 15:10 a slight collision occurred near B 840, Argyll and Bute involving 1 vehicle and 1 casualty (1 slight) Weather at the time was recorded as snowing no high winds. Road surface conditions were snow. Lighting was described as daylight. A police officer attended the scene.
